Transaction 705224efbe8f646aee8bf07101848bd4c359c6505cba51528e753a1f45b5b124
1 Input
1 Output
-
705224efbe8f646aee8bf07101848bd4c359c6505cba51528e753a1f45b5b124:0
- value
- 21923003
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ca0910a5e06943d4f3955da286a8860460e204a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KRGMbkXZcsgR1NMNmrd7ACuaaEfB9pfzo